How they compare

Angola currently reports 2,357 against 2,225 in Bosnia and Herzegovina, a difference of 132.

That makes Angola's figure about 1.1 times Bosnia and Herzegovina's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 24 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Bosnia and Herzegovina ahead.

Angola ranks 81st and Bosnia and Herzegovina ranks 82nd of 224 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, Angola averaged higher in 1 and Bosnia and Herzegovina in 2.

This dataset provides information on electricity generation and installed capacity, categorized by energy type (renewable and non-renewable) and five technology types (Fossil fuels, Hydropower, Solar energy, Wind energy, and Bioenergy). The data has been sourced from the International Renewable Energy Agency (https://pxweb.irena.org/pxweb/en/IRENASTAT). The indicators on energy transition have been formulated to help users understand the progress in the adoption of renewable energy sources vis-à-vis the increasing energy requirements.
